首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

MySQL:添加具有空值的列

MySQL是一种常用的关系型数据库管理系统,它提供了一个可靠、高效的数据存储和访问解决方案。在MySQL中,可以使用ALTER TABLE语句来添加具有空值的列。

具体步骤如下:

  1. 打开MySQL客户端或者使用可视化工具(如phpMyAdmin)连接到MySQL服务器。
  2. 选择要进行操作的数据库,可以使用以下命令切换到目标数据库:
代码语言:txt
复制
USE database_name;
  1. 使用ALTER TABLE语句添加具有空值的列。语法如下:
代码语言:txt
复制
ALTER TABLE table_name
ADD column_name data_type NULL;

其中,table_name是要添加列的表名,column_name是要添加的列名,data_type是列的数据类型,NULL表示允许空值。

例如,要向名为users的表中添加一个名为email的列,数据类型为VARCHAR(255)且允许空值,可以执行以下命令:

代码语言:txt
复制
ALTER TABLE users
ADD email VARCHAR(255) NULL;

这样就成功地向表中添加了具有空值的列。

MySQL的优势包括:

  • 可靠性:MySQL提供了事务支持和ACID(原子性、一致性、隔离性、持久性)特性,确保数据的完整性和一致性。
  • 性能:MySQL使用了高效的索引和查询优化技术,能够处理大量的数据请求,并提供快速的查询响应时间。
  • 可扩展性:MySQL支持主从复制、分区和分片等扩展性特性,能够方便地应对高并发和大规模数据存储需求。
  • 开源性:MySQL是开源软件,免费使用,并且有庞大的开源社区提供支持和贡献。
  • 灵活性:MySQL支持多种编程语言和操作系统,能够与各种应用和环境进行无缝集成。

MySQL的应用场景包括:

  • Web应用程序:MySQL广泛应用于各种Web应用程序中,如电子商务网站、社交网络、新闻门户等。
  • 数据分析:MySQL提供了强大的数据查询和分析功能,可用于处理大数据和进行复杂的数据分析任务。
  • 日志存储:MySQL可以作为日志存储引擎,记录和分析系统、应用和网络的日志数据。
  • 企业级应用:MySQL可满足企业级应用的数据库需求,如ERP、CRM、人力资源管理等。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 云数据库MySQL:https://cloud.tencent.com/product/cdb_mysql
  • 弹性MapReduce(EMR):https://cloud.tencent.com/product/emr
  • 数据仓库(TDSQL):https://cloud.tencent.com/product/tdsql

以上是关于MySQL添加具有空值的列的完善且全面的答案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券